  Senior Pilot Career Counseling
(for the Retired Airline Pilot)

WANT TO FLY PAST AGE 65?  OPPORTUNITIES ARE AVAILABLE; HOW TO MARKET YOURSELF 
 

Our Senior Pilot Career Counseling is designed for retired airline or mature career pilots who want to continue flying after age 65, but have limited data on who's hiring, what they offer and how to approach them properly. Our counselors will help you plan your job search, prepare a professional resume, complete job applications which sell your skills and help you market yourself to potential pilot employers.

You Should Consider :

  • Who is getting hired - do you fit the profile? 
  • Your resume - is it current and does it present you in the best light?
  • Job search action plan - is yours an aggressive one, tailored to your desires?
  • Type-Specific Training/Ratings - should you purchase training now or later?
  • Refresher Training - are you current on Part 91/135 regs and GA flying? 
  • Marketing Yourself - obstacles you'll encounter and how to sell your skills
